Nazarbayev University Student Dies in Apparent Suicide
Photo: nu.edu.kz
A student at Nazarbayev University has died in Astana after jumping from a dormitory window, Orda.kz reports.
Psychologists are now working with students in the aftermath of the tragedy.
The incident occurred on August 15, and the university confirmed the student’s death today.
We deeply regret to inform you of the tragic incident that occurred on the Nazarbayev University campus. The university expresses its sincere condolences to the family and loved ones of the deceased and shares their profound loss. All necessary response measures were promptly taken. Emergency services and law enforcement agencies have been involved, the university’s administration said in an official statement.
Psychologists are providing support to the student’s relatives, classmates, and loved ones. The university’s press service added that the family requested that personal information and details of the incident not be disclosed.
Orda.kz's sources noted that the student did this due to personal reasons and that the incident was not related to her studies.
The Astana Police Department confirmed that a criminal case has been opened. Police also stated that the student was 22 years old and fell from the 12th floor of the dormitory.
On July 18, another Nazarbayev University student was found dead in a dormitory.
